About AMS
AMS specialises in the supply, installation and maintenance of woodworking machinery from brands including SCM, Homag, Robland, Weinig and Striebig.
Our customers range from small workshops to major UK manufacturing facilities, so no two days are the same. We also sell, service and support Wadkin, Wadkin Bursgreen, Doucet, Bala and Stenner machinery and are the main UK and Ireland dealer for Leadermac.

The role
Working as part of our experienced Field Service Team, you will:
Diagnose electrical and mechanical breakdowns and faults
Service, repair and install specialist machinery
Fit replacement parts and test equipment
Complete planned preventative maintenance
Respond to emergency call-outs and unplanned repairs
Liaise with the Service Department at head office
Complete all required paperwork promptly
Maintain excellent workmanship and safety standards
Support our head-office workshop engineers when required
The position involves regular travel and occasional overnight stays. All associated costs are covered by AMS.
